Dicker Data Momentum Analysis

Momentum indicators are widely used technical indicators which help to measure the pace at which the price of specific equity, such as Dicker, fluctuates. Many momentum indicators also complement each other and can be helpful when the market is rising or falling as compared to Dicker
  
Dicker Data's Momentum analyses are specifically helpful, as they help investors time the market using mark points where the market can reverse. The reversal spots are usually identified through divergence between price movement and momentum.

Auto-correlation

    
  0.46  

Average predictability

Dicker Data has average predictability. Overlapping area represents the amount of predictability between Dicker Data time series from 30th of October 2025 to 14th of December 2025 and 14th of December 2025 to 28th of January 2026. The more autocorrelation exist between current time interval and its lagged values, the more accurately you can make projection about the future pattern of Dicker Data price movement. The serial correlation of 0.46 indicates that about 46.0% of current Dicker Data price fluctuation can be explain by its past prices.

Dicker Data technical stock analysis exercises models and trading practices based on price and volume transformations, such as the moving averages, relative strength index, regressions, price and return correlations, business cycles, stock market cycles, or different charting patterns.
A focus of Dicker Data technical analysis is to determine if market prices reflect all relevant information impacting that market. A technical analyst looks at the history of Dicker Data trading pattern rather than external drivers such as economic, fundamental, or social events. It is believed that price action tends to repeat itself due to investors' collective, patterned behavior. Hence technical analysis focuses on identifiable price trends and conditions. More Info...
